Mikestony give the following:

In the op of the rom, post 2(?) you will see 2 different downloads for DTa2sd.
Pick one, I use the beta version myself.
Download it and transfer to your sd card.
Flash from recovery.
Wipe cache and dalvik then flash.
then reboot.
It should move your apps to the sd ext. upon reboot.
If not, go into Terminal Emulator and enter this commmand.

a2sd reinstall

Presto! apps to sd done!
Double check in TB
